Today’s the day my son finds out I’m not Superman.

In this episode of 'I'm Quitting Alcohol', comedian David Boyle shares an amusing yet insightful tale about his journey in sobriety and the trials of fatherhood. You'll hear about Boyle's jiu-jitsu adventures, where he grapples not just with opponents but also with his own fitness and the expectations of his young son.

With a mix of humour and honesty, Boyle recounts how his son watched him wrestle for the first time, leading to some humbling moments and valuable life lessons about hard work and perseverance. Boyle’s candid reflections on his struggles to stay fit and be a role model for his son are both relatable and entertaining.

As he transitions from the physical battleground to sharing a listener's wild story from Las Vegas, Boyle keeps you engaged with his unique blend of comedy and real-life experiences. This episode wraps up with a hilarious tale involving a Mustang GT, a run-in with the law, and the unpredictable nature of life in Vegas.
